What is the difference between soprano and alto recorder?

The alto recorder is based on the pitch F and is a little longer and more expensive than soprano recorders. The soprano recorder is a fifth higher and based on C. The alto is great for older, advanced students and teachers, while the soprano is perfect for beginners and carrying the melody.

What are the names of the five main recorders?

The 5 main types of recorders used in recorder consorts (ensembles) are sopranino, soprano, alto, tenor, and bass. There are other specialty recorders as well.

What is the difference between soprano and tenor recorder?

The soprano and tenor both have a bottom note of C. The tenor sounds an octave lower than the soprano. They play in the same way apart from the tenor is much bigger! These tend to be the most common choice as many people learn the soprano recorder at school.

Modern recorders

Ranges of the modern recorder family
In CIn F
soprano or descant in C5 (c″)alto or treble in F4 (f′)
tenor in C4 (c′)bass or basset in F3 (f)
(great) bass or quart-bass in C3 (c)contrabass or great bass or sub-bass in F2 (F)

Should I start on alto or soprano recorder?

Probably the two most common recorder voices that beginners learn to play are soprano and alto; which one you might choose could depend on a number of factors. We recommend that you begin on the alto recorder. The alto is a great choice if you plan to play in a group with other recorder players.

Why is the recorder hated?

So why the bad reputation? One reason is that many school music teachers aren’t trained recorder players. They can play some notes, but they might lack proper technique. Like any instrument, the intricacy of fingering, breath pressure and tonguing to perfect intonation and sound quality needs to be learnt.
